压缩空气在工业上被广泛使用,其耗电量相当大。据英国统计,工业中10%的电能是用于压缩空气。在我国一般工厂中,空压站的负荷均在70%以上,其年耗电费用约为其一次投资。由于空压机都是常年运转的,因此,只要能节约1~2%的电能,也是值得考虑的。压缩空气系统的节能可以分为以下几个方面:空压机传动及台数选择;降低管道损失;避免局部降压使用;冷却水系统的节能;堵漏、维修;降低吸气、排气温度;冷却水废热回收。现就这几个方面分述如下。
